Fenton Reporter
The Fenton Reporter, founded in 1899 by local entrepreneurs in Fenton, Iowa, has long been a cornerstone of community journalism, initially established to serve the informational needs of a growing rural population. Over the years, it has evolved while maintaining a commitment to local news, receiving several accolades for its in-depth coverage of community events, agriculture, and local government. Known for trustworthy reporting and factual accuracy, the Fenton Reporter reflects the values of the Fenton community. On OldNews.com, you would find scans of the Fenton Reporter starting 1912, including 10,431 scans in total.
